Devaraj Ranganna fd74d678a7 psa: Remove PSA secure binary building tools
The PSA-implementing secure binary is not built using Mbed OS build
tools anymore. Instead, the TrustedFirmware-M (TF-M) build system is
used to produce the secure binary. As such, we remove PSA related hooks
from the build system, remove PSA related scripts from tools/test
folder, and also remove the psa-autogen job from travis which was
running the now unecessary and removed generate_partition_code.py.

Remove the ability to generate new PSA binaries in the old manner, where
Mbed OS implements PSA. We don't yet remove any PSA binaries or break
the currently checked-in Mbed-implemented PSA support. PSA targets
integrated in the old manner will continue working at this point.

Martin Kojtal 0995ece3b2 Add scancode evaluate script
The goal: check license offenders in pull request

This is similar to what astyle does in Travis. We get list of files being changed. Because scancode does not support list of files being scanned but rather a file or directory, we copy files to SCANCODE folder. Execute scancode license check in this folder and check for offenders.

The rules there are: code files must have a license and SDPX identifier. If they don't, we print these and ask for review.

It functions nicely there is just one workaround needed. SPDX is not always 100 percent correctly found, therefore we recheck file if no SPDX manually in the script. This proves to remove false positives.

Rajkumar Kanagaraj 957dca2082 Enabling small C library option and deprecating uARM toolchain
- By default, Mbed OS build tools use standard C library for all supported toolchains.
   It is possible to use smaller C libraries by overriding the "target.default_lib" option
   with "small". This option is only currently supported for the GCC_ARM toolchain.
   This override config option is now extended in the build tool for ARM toolchain.
 - Add configuration option to specify libraries supported for each toolchain per targets.
 - Move __aeabi_assert function from rtos to retarget code so it’s available for bare metal.
 - Use 2 memory region model for ARM toolchain scatter file for the following targets:
   NUCLEO_F207ZG, STM32F411xE, STM32F429xI, NUCLEO_L073RZ, STM32F303xE
 - Add a warning message in the build tools to deprecate uARM toolchain.
 - NewLib-Nano C library is not supporting floating-point and printf with %hhd,%hhu,%hhX,%lld,%llu,%llX
   format specifier so skipping those green tea test cases.

Hugues Kamba 051991fafb mbed_retarget: Add a minimal console implementation to provide basic functionalities
The retarget code allocates an array of FileHandle* for console and file
handling (filehandles). A tiny target only needs a console (putc/getc).
There is no need for file handling.

The POSIX layer and the array of FileHandle* is not required for small
targets that only need a console ; this code is optionally compiled
out if the configuration parameter platform.stdio-minimal-console-only is
set to `"true"`.

Hugues Kamba 5933dec3b7 Harmonise Doxygen comments in drivers, events, platform and rtos dirs
When a Doxygen group has been defined (created), all its needed to add
documentation to that group is `\addtogroup`. Since all the information
about the group is preserved, it is not necessary to mention the group
hierarchy again with `\ingroup`. This PR removes unnecessary Doxygen lines
across the `drivers`, `events`, `platform` and `rtos` directories.

It also ensures that new groups are created with `\defgroup` once and
referenced with `\addtogroup` whenever documentation needs to be added to
an existing group.

Kevin Bracey 0bb4c050b7 SingletonPtr: API extensions, make constexpr
* Adjust definition to make the default constructor `constexpr`.
  This permits use in classes that want lazy initialization and their
  own `constexpr` constructor, such as `mstd::mutex`.

* Add `get_no_init()` method to allow an explicit optimisation for
  paths that know they won be the first call (such as
  `mstd::mutex::unlock`).

* Add `destroy()` method to permit destruction of the contained object.
  (`SingletonPtr`'s destructor does not call its destructor - a cheat
  to omit destructors of static objects). Needed if using in a class
  that needs proper destruction.
